Stockton, California has 4 business administration schools for you to consider if you are interested in pursuing a degree in business administration. Stockton has a total population of 243,771 and a student population of 29,263. Of these students, 29,036 are enrolled in schools that offer business administration programs.
Stockton's largest business administration school is University of the Pacific. In 2010, University of the Pacific graduated approximately 192 students with credentials in business administration.
A total of 284 students graduated with credentials in business administration from business administration schools in Stockton in 2010. If you decide to attend a business administration school in Stockton, you can expect to pay an average yearly tuition of $13,704.
In addition to tuition costs, plan on spending an average of $1,620 for business administration related books and supplies each year. And if you live on campus, you will face an additional expense of $10,616 per year, on average, for room and board. If you live at home, you can cut this cost down to approximately $13,303.
If you decide to work as a general manager in Stockton, your job prospects are not very good. In 2010, there were 250,900 general managers in California. Of these general managers, 2,630 were working in the greater Stockton area. By the year 2018, the number of general managers is expected to decrease by -2% in Stockton. This projected change is slower than the projected nationwide trend for general managers.
